    Capt. Long Pham, a training and readiness public affairs officer with U.S. Army Reserve Command, waits for a steak to sear with butter shortly after dropping it into a cast-iron skillet at Fort McCoy, Wisconsin, July 20, 2019. (U.S. Army Reserve photo by Sgt. David Graves)
